Output 591b42d1e75b6c50eb2fc961f025c04895628f31f3feea5daa9f2ed77e477d32:0

value
509463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ec442ff44b7877053e847492e6980b67c5817ea OP_EQUAL
address
34VhJoRQDkDJLDsapxqcR2McXFAzQAnH3x
transaction
591b42d1e75b6c50eb2fc961f025c04895628f31f3feea5daa9f2ed77e477d32
spent
true